EISENZIMMER v. CITY OF BALFOUR

Civ. No. 10584.

352 N.W.2d 628 (1984)

Wendelin EISENZIMMER, Petitioner and Appellant, v. CITY OF BALFOUR, a Municipal Corporation, and Other Interested Persons, Respondents and Appellees.

Supreme Court of North Dakota.

July 18, 1984.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Clifford C. Grosz, Harvey, for petitioner and appellant (submitted on brief).

Michael S. McIntee, Towner, for respondent and appellee City of Balfour (submitted on brief).


VANDE WALLE, Justice.

Wendelin Eisenzimmer appealed from a "judgment" of the district court of McHenry County denying his petition to vacate a portion of the plat of the City of Balfour. We affirm the order denying the petition.
